Module/Course Code BA CORE COURSE 5
Module Name/Course Title Human Resource Management
Units 3
Semester Taught 1st Term
Module Coordinator/s Ms. Jana Patricia Avengoza
Module Learning Outcomes On successful completion of this module, students should
with reference to the be able to:
Undergraduate Attributes LO1: Develop a solid theoretical background in
and how they are developed management & organizational behavior and be
in discipline prepared for general management and supervisory
positions
LO2: Enhance skills in introducing own voice to prepare
and critically review any report and examine the
relationship between the individual, group and the
organization.
LO3: Determine how technology and diversity shapes
human resource management in the workplace
LO4: Explore practical implications of social psychology
and sociology
LO5: Understand the importance of ethics and CSR in
business decision making
Module Content This module covers major issues impacting on human
resource management in organization including
demographic & social change, ethics in HRM, managing
diversity, assessment center techniques, the impact of
government legislation on HRM.
Objectives Lesson 1: Introduction
- Explain and differentiate the different roles and
functions of the Human Resource Manager
- Explain the career development of a Human
Resource Manager
- Have an idea on how different methods of human
resource recruitment are done
- Know the advantages & disadvantages of the
different methods of recruitment
Lesson 2: Development of Human Resources
- Describe performance appraisal programs and its
different methods
- Point out the criteria in promoting and demoting an
employee
- Expound the facts on when an employee’s
separation is considered positive or negative
Lesson 3: Maintenance and Rewarding of Employees
- Discuss strategic objectives of compensations and
explain the concept of market rate
- Identify employee benefits, pension, and
allowances
- Tell how employee morale is the corporate version
of good health
Lesson 4: Maintenance and Rewarding of Employees
- Discuss the government agencies and their
functions to ensure that both rights of employees
and employers are protected
- Know the government regulations on employment
and their different functions

Lesson 5: Utilization of Manpower
- Discuss the different kinds of planning techniques in
human resource management
- Enumerate different applications of competency
framework
Discussion & Content Lesson 1: Introduction
➢ Main Trends in the HR Profession
➢ Acquisition of Human Resources
- Job Analysis
- Recruitment
- Selection
Lesson 2: Development of Human Resources
➢ Training
➢ Performance Review
➢ Changes in Personnel Status
Lesson 3: Maintenance and Rewarding of Employees
➢ Compensation
➢ Employee Benefits & Services
➢ Employee Morale & Motivation
➢ Health & Safety in the Workplace
Lesson 4: Maintenance and Rewarding of Employees
➢ Labor Management Relations
➢ Basic Labor Law
➢ Employee Relations & Employee Discipline
➢ Employee Grievances
Lesson 5: Utilization of Manpower
➢ Human Resource Planning
➢ Career Management & Development
